I was considering getting a front dozer blade I found locally. It's about an hour drive so I thought I would gather opinions before deciding to head out.

The seller says it's either Dearborn or Ford. I assume it's labeled as dearborn. It's a model that uses the rear 3pt to raise and lower the blade via cables.

The only informed questions I could ask were if it had been welded/repaired and it all he had all the parts (no, yes, respectively).

He's asking $250. Worth a look? These seem somewhat rare.

Hey Rob, I'm pretty sure that this implement uses the same sub-frame as the 19-2 snow blade talked about in the last few days. If you scroll down to that post, you'll see my response with a picture of the frame for the blade. It may help you check out the prospective purchase to ensure that you do indeed have all the key parts.
